First of all I'd like to apologize for my very bad English. I'll try to do my best!
I started to hear the rattle noise just a bit after the first service (1000 km aprox). Even though everybody told me that I was being paranoic and that noise was absolutely normal, I wasn't very confident with it. However I kept riding my motorbike everyday just trying to forget that slight but awful rattle noise...
Last friday I discovered this thread (and others related) and noticed that I wasn't the only with the same problem, since I found the issue described exactly as it is:
- Rattle noise coming from the right side of the engine.
- It gets louder next to 4000rpm
- It disappears when the engine gets warmer.
I took some notes about the new Yamaha's replacement for the cam chain tensioner and the way to adjust it manually to describe it to mechanic in the repair shop where I bought the bike. And when I was ready to go there, I started the engine and the sound just wasn't there!
By that time I had already done 3500 km aprox. I've been riding all this week (300 km aprox) and I haven't heard the noise again. Well, it sometimes sounds during the first 5 seconds after starting the engine.
I'm not sure if it is just a matter of luck or it is normal, or even if the noise will come back soon...but I wanted to share it with you, as it can bring a little of hope for those who are as annoyed as I was!
